Depends on what series you are watching. In Gundam Wing, gundams are just mobile suits made of Gundanium (sp?). In Gundam Seed they were mobile suits with phase-shift armor (or something like that). In Gundam 00 only suits made by Celestial beings are called Gundams. Other series may vary.They also have 2 pointy things on the head.Also, a Gundam in the UC is nothing more than a name.It is not a specific line of mobile suits.It is not a "type" of mobile suit even if it is referred to as "Gundam-Type Mobile Suit." All Gundams post the RX-78 series are named in a traditional fashion, not designed in accordance with.It is not a series of aesthetics such as V-fin as the Victory Gundam Hexa, and others, lack this feature but are still Gundams. The Hyaku Shiki was originally called the Delta Gundam but did not posess a V-fin or Gundam-style face.don't make this question complicated mangundams are just robots with "V" shaped aerials.

Gundam, by a long shot. Neon Genesis Evangelion originally aired in 1995 and early 1996, with the manga debuting several months prior to promote the anime. The Gundam franchise, on the other hand, debuted in April of 1979 with the original Mobile Suit Gundam series.
There are a total of 3 endings for Mobile Suit: Gundam Seed Ending Song 1: "Anna Ni Issho Datta No Ni" by See-Saw (Phase 01-26) Ending Song 2: "River/Mizuiro no Ame" by Tatsuya Ishii (Phase 27-39) Ending Song 3: "Find the Way" by Mika Nakashima (Phase 40-50)
